MindPoint Group is seeking an Incident Response Analyst to support threat monitoring, detection, event analysis and incident reporting. The Security Operations Center is a 24/7 environment. The Incident Response Analyst will be responsible for monitoring enterprise networks and systems, detecting events and reporting on any and all threats that are directed against those systems regardless of their classification level or type. The Incident Response Analyst is expected to collaborate with leadership to develop metrics based on situational awareness and threat monitoring at an enterprise level that will be reported based on the approved plan and supporting checklists. The Incident Response Analyst must be able to rapidly address security.
Typically, the client’s sensor grid acquires millions of events per day and events are analyzed and categorized in accordance with the Cyber Security Incident Response Plan. The Incident Response Analyst will provide the client with a full comprehensive array of analytical activities in support of external threat monitoring, detection, event analysis and incident reporting efforts to include: presentation reviews, internal and external threat reporting, analysis of inbound and outbound public internet traffic, suspicious e-mail messages, administer access request to specific public sites, communicate and coordinate the characterization of events and the response.
The Incident Response Analyst shall orient their skill sets to the following tools (this is not a complete inventory):
ArcSight SIEM
Splunk
RSA Netwitness
FireEye
Sourcefire (Snort)
Bro IDS
Fidelis XPS
HB Gary Active Defense
